Alexander, 1818-1895 Hymnal: Hymns for a Pilgrim People #137 (2007) Meter: 8.7.8.7.7.7 Lyrics: 1 Once in royal David's city Stood a lowly cattle shed, Where a mother laid her baby In a manger for His bed. Mary was that mother mild, Jesus Christ her little Child. 2 He came down to earth from heaven Who is God and Lord of all, And His shelter was a stable, And His cradle was a stall. With the poor, oppressed, and lowly Lived on earth our Savior holy. 3 And through all His wondrous childhood He would honor and obey, Love and watch the lowly maiden In whose gentle arms He lay. Christian children all should be Kind, obedient, good as He. 4 Jesus is our childhood's pattern, Day by day like us He grew; He was little, weak, and helpless, Tears and smiles like us He knew: And He feels for all our sadness, And He shares in all our gladness. 5 And our eyes at last shall see Him, Through His own redeeming love; For that Child so dear and gentle Is our Lord in heav'n above: And He leads His children on To the place where He has gone. Topics: Children; Christmas; Heaven; Jesus Christ; Second Coming Scripture: Isaiah 9:7 Languages: English Tune Title: IRBY
